Job Summary
The Senior Functional Tester - Embedded Software plays a critical role in ensuring the quality and functionality of software applications through comprehensive testing. This role involves creating and executing test cases, tracking metrics, and collaborating with both the development team and clients to meet quality standards and client requirements, thus contributing significantly to the overall success of the project.
Key Responsibilities
- Review and analyze the test basis (e.g., specifications, requirements, technical documents) to ensure clarity, completeness, and testability, etc.
- Develop detailed test specifications.
- Verify readiness of the test infrastructure, including environments, tools, test data, and configurations. Utilize various testing platforms to simulate real‑world operating conditions and validate system performance, functionality, and reliability.
- Develop & execute both automation and manual test cases. Implement, run, and maintain automated test scripts to enhance efficiency, coverage, and repeatability.
- Analyze software and system defects, perform root cause analysis, and implement corrective and preventive actions with development teams. Document defects clearly, accurately, and in a timely manner in defect tracking systems.
- Analyze and summarize test results, identify potential risks, and report progress to engineering teams, stakeholders, and VnV Test Coordinators. Ensure proper archiving and maintenance of test artifacts (test cases, reports, logs, scripts, and test data).
Skill Requirements
- Fluent in English, written and spoken
- Major in Computer Science, Engineering, or a related field of study.
- General knowledge of a test lifecycle
- Knowledge of test design, specification methods and scripting languages.
- The ability to review and use test design and specification methods
- AUTOSAR BSW components: Foundation about BSW (Communication, Diagnostic, Failure Management).
- Knowledge of CAN fundamentals and associated standards such as ISO-11898.
- Diagnostic Protocols: Familiarity with UDS as defined by ISO-14229 and diagnostic communication over CAN (ISO-15765).
- Good scripting skills in Python, CAPL (or C) for:
- Test automation
- Test report analysis
- ECU simulation and testing
- Experience working in the CANoe environment is highly recommended.
- Proven experience in embedded systems testing within the automotive industry. Formal software testing certification (e.g., ISTQB Certified Tester) is highly desirable.
- Excellent troubleshooting, root cause analysis, and issue-resolution skills
- Ability to work both collaboratively in teams and independently
